It's to override the cruise control:
Touch brakes: CC goes off
Stamp on Throttle: CC goes off

He means that all throttle pedals will have it, even if they don't have CC connected. Mainly so they don't have to manufacture 2 types of throttle pedal hence saves money ;)
 
Erm I dunno, was just trying to explain what he said!

I know that cars with a speed limiter tend to have a clicky button to override the limiter though (as merely pressing the throttle will only accelerate until and not surpass the speed set on the limiter).
